Laurantzonfjellet
Laurantzonfjellet is a peak in Spitsbergen, Svalbard and has an elevation of 100 metres.- Type: Peak with an elevation of 100 metres
- Description: mountain in Svalbard, Norway
- Also known as: “Laurantzon”, “Mount Chisholm”, and “Mount Laurantzon”

Hellandfjellet is a mountain in Prins Karls Forland, Svalbard. It has a height of 571 m.a.s.l., and is located at the northern part of the island. The mountain is named after Norwegian geologist Amund Helland.
